Paragraph Counter: practical guide

Paragraph count is a structure check. It shows whether a draft is made of breathable sections or one long block that readers will abandon.

Use it for essays, landing pages, newsletters, product copy and support docs before publishing.

Practical notes

  • Short paragraphs help mobile readers.
  • Long paragraphs can work when they carry one clear idea.
  • Count structure together with headings and bullets.

Common mistakes

  • Breaking every sentence into its own paragraph.
  • Leaving long walls of text on mobile pages.
  • Using paragraph count without checking meaning.
